Thermal Management Systems Engineer Contractor Beehive Industries is dedicated to Powering American Defense by revolutionizing the design, development, and delivery of jet propulsion systems to support the warfighter. Through the integration of additive manufacturing, the company aims to meet the growing and urgent needs for unmanned aerial defense by dramatically improving a jet engine’s speed to market, fuel efficiency, and cost. Founded in 2020, the company is headquartered in Englewood, Colorado, with additional facilities in Knoxville, Tennessee, Loveland, Ohio, and Mount Vernon, Ohio. Beehive is committed to grow and advance the defense industrial base while manufacturing exclusively in the USA. This role will be remote.
Role Overview We are seeking aSenior Engineer, Thermal Management Systems that can execute the design, analysis, and evaluation of turbomachinery components and assemblies using sound engineering principles while meeting industry standards and program requirements. This includes evaluation of the effects of the overall system (maneuvers, dynamic modes, limit load cases, transient and/or steady state heat transfer, etc.) on components and assemblies. Thisrole willinitially be an individual contributor comfortable working in a dynamic self-directed start-up environment. As the organization grows, this role willbe responsible forscaling design capability to supportadditionalprojects which may include some future team leadership. Being able to grow leadership capabilities with the role will be critical.
